The Body Doesn't Heal Without Sleep
When we rest, our bodies go into fixing mode. Muscles recoup, cells regrow, and our immune system enhances. It's a time when the body cleanses and recovers. However when rest is interrupted or when it's regularly poor quality, this entire procedure is disrupted.
With time, a lack of correct rest can bring about weakened resistance, making you more prone to diseases. Also injuries heal a lot more slowly when you're sleep-deprived. Chronic inadequate rest has likewise been connected to a higher danger of establishing lasting health problems like heart problem, diabetes, and hypertension.
A good night's remainder isn't a deluxe-- it's a necessity for the body to work effectively.

Emotional Resilience Depends on Quality Rest
Ever discover exactly how your persistence wears thin after a bad night's rest? That's no coincidence. Rest and feelings are deeply intertwined.
When you're well-rested, you're much better geared up to control your emotions and respond to demanding scenarios. Without rest, little troubles can feel frustrating. This occurs since the brain's psychological facility ends up being overactive, while the area in charge of logical thinking slows down.
State of mind swings, irritation, anxiety, and also depressive episodes can all be connected to poor rest. Emotional security relies upon getting consistent, deep remainder. And if interrupted rest ends up being a pattern, it may be time to check out if a deeper concern is at play.

Hormonal Imbalance and Weight Gain
Yes, sleep affects your weight-- and not just because you're too exhausted to hit the gym.
Sleep plays a major role in regulating the hormonal agents that regulate cravings and metabolic rate. When you're sleep-deprived, your body generates even more ghrelin (the appetite hormone) and less leptin (the hormonal agent that makes you really feel complete). This discrepancy commonly causes boosted hunger and unhealthy food selections.
In addition, persistent bad sleep can disrupt insulin sensitivity, increasing the threat of kind 2 diabetic issues. Your body's ability to manage blood glucose relies greatly on rest, making it vital for overall metabolic wellness.
